Dividend, bonus, stock split this week: Several corporate actions, including dividend payouts, stock splits and bonus issues, are scheduled for the week beginning June 23. The list includes names like Dalmia Bharat, GNA Axles, Hindustan Unilever, Kalpataru Projects International, Samvardhana Motherson, and Vedanta, among others.

Shares of FMCG giant Hindustan Unilever Ltd will trade ex-dividend for the final dividend of ₹24 per share on June 23, 2025. The record date for the same is June 23.
V-Mart Retail, a family fashion store chain, has fixed June 23 to determine shareholders eligible for a bonus share issue. The company is issuing three equity shares for every one existing share of the company.

Equity benchmark indices NIFTY and SENSEX tumbled on Monday amid heightened geopolitical tensions after the US bombed three major nuclear sites in Iran.

The SENSEX tumbled 836 points to 81,571, while NIFTY dropped 256 points to 24,855 at 10:14 am. The US bombed three major nuclear sites -- Fordow, Natanz and Isfahan -- in Iran, bringing itself into the Israel-Iran conflict.

Shares of Hindustan Unilever were trading 0.84% lower at ₹2,263 per unit, while Dalmia Bharat stock was up 0.78% to ₹2,051 apiece.

From the NIFTY firms, Infosys, Shriram Finance, JSW Steel, HCL Tech, TCS, Mahindra & Mahindra, Wipro and Hero MotoCorp were the biggest laggards.
